The Staff Power Design Engineer will design and develop power conversion architectures using the latest technologies from Linear Technology, Texas Instruments, and other integrated circuit device manufacturers. Power Design Engineers work with system, sub-system, and hardware engineers to develop requirements, architect new circuit design topologies, and printed wiring board layouts. Designs are verified through spice simulation, laboratory verification, and formal qualification to electrical and mechanical environmental requirements, electromagnetic environmental effects (E3) requirements and EMI/EMC compliance requirements. Design support is continuous from requirements definition through integration and test; and maintenance of design documentation and configuration management is required throughout the product life-cycle.
